Koyo Zom is the highest peak in the Hindu Raj mountain range in Pakistan at 6,872 metres (22,546 ft).[4] The Hindu Raj mountain range lies between the Hindu Kush and the Karakoram ranges.
Koyo Zom is located on the boundary of the Khyber Pakhtunkhwa and Gilgit-Baltistan provinces of Pakistan. It was first climbed by an Austrian expedition in 1968.
